Transforming homes and businesses in El Granada is more than just choosing colors and furniture; it’s about capturing the coastal charm and balancing practicality with beauty. As seasoned interior designers specializing in this picturesque community, we understand the unique challenges and opportunities that come with designing in a seaside town. From maximizing natural light in foggy mornings to using durable, fade-resistant fabrics that withstand salty air, every design decision is tailored to complement the local environment. Whether you’re refreshing a Spanish-style home near the cliffs or reimagining a cozy condo in a bustling neighborhood, we deliver designs that are as functional as they are visually stunning.
El Granada’s architectural diversity also brings unique considerations. Historic homes often require a delicate touch to preserve their original charm while adhering to HOA or historic district guidelines. Multifamily residences may demand soundproofing solutions or finish approvals to keep neighbors happy. These details are critical, and our experience navigating local requirements ensures a seamless process from concept to completion. For projects involving structural changes, the San Mateo County Planning and Building Department oversees approvals, but most interior projects stay within design boundaries, saving time and hassle.
Pricing for interior design services in El Granada ranges based on project scope. Hourly rates average $100–$300, while flat fees start at $2,500 per room. Percentage-based fees typically range from 10–25% of the total renovation budget. The cost of hiring an interior designer or decorator varies widely based on factors like the scope of the project, the designer's experience, and your location. On average, interior design services range from $2,000 to $12,000 nationwide for a single room project. Hourly rates typically fall between $50 and $200 per hour, while flat-rate project fees range from $500 to $25,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the job. Premium designers may charge significantly more. Always compare quotes and understand what's included in the pricing, such as consultations, design plans, and material selections.
To find a licensed and certified interior designer in El Granada, start by checking local directories and review platforms. Many states don't require specific licenses for interior designers, but certifications from organizations like the National Council for Interior Design Qualification (NCIDQ) can indicate expertise. Check with El Granada's local consumer affairs office or lookup a trusted database like NCIDQ Certification Directory to ensure your designer meets professional standards. Always ask about their qualifications during the consultation.
The timeline for an interior design project depends on the size and complexity of the job. For a single room, it may take 4 to 12 weeks from concept to completion. Larger spaces or entire home projects can take 3 to 12 months or more. Factors like order lead times, furniture customization, availability of contractors, and client approvals can extend the timeline. Discuss this topic upfront to align expectations with your designer.

Yes, most professional interior designers are required to have liability insurance to protect themselves and their clients. This insurance covers damages or legal issues that may arise during the project, such as accidental property damage. Before hiring, ask the designer if they carry insurance and request a proof of coverage. This safeguards you in case of unforeseen circumstances.
Yes, interior designers often assist with renovations and remodeling. Their expertise in structural layouts, material selection, and space planning can enhance the functionality and aesthetics of your remodel. They frequently collaborate with architects and contractors to ensure renovation projects run smoothly. For extensive remodels, seek a designer who specializes in construction and has experience managing similar projects.

Yes, interior designers in El Granada must comply with local building codes, safety standards, and regulations for any structural changes or renovations. These codes ensure that electrical wiring, plumbing, and other elements meet safety guidelines. For more information, consult your local building department's website or resources, such as the International Code Council (ICC). Your designer or contractor should also handle necessary permits and inspections.
